    I think the point is what are the rules to separate teams that are tied.

    As far as I know it's:

    1. Head to head points.
    2. Head to head GD (i.e., if one team ends up winning 1-0 but the other wins 3-0, then the 3-0 team goes though).
    3. Total group GD against all teams.

    The key here is that Israel are no better off having drawn 2-2 in Dublin vs. our 1-1 in Israel. At this stage "away goals" in the head to heads are NOT a factor though UEFA can do what they want to do I suppose.

    In a WC finals it'd be a toss of a coin (remember our group in 1990?).

    There's a potential situation as follows:

    Let's say Switzerland and Israel draw.

    Ireland beats France.
    France beats Switzerland
    Switzerland beats us.

    All 3 of us have 19 points.

    Each of the winners in the matches above wins the head to head between those teams, but no clear winner emerges because we each win one head to head and lose one head to head.

    I think on that basis overall GD applies.
